Ordinals
beta
Sat 943376655985582
decimal
188675.1655985582
degree
0°188675′1187″1655985582‴
percentile
44.92269795349032%
name
hdzqhcvpfqp
cycle
0
epoch
0
period
93
block
188675
offset
1655985582
timestamp
2012-07-12 06:47:50 UTC
rarity
common
prev
next